5.0 out of 5 stars Eudemonic, one point in time for the Steve Kimock Band, September 15, 2005
By J. Hargraves (Massachusetts)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
The Steve Kimock Band (SKB) is an evolutionary musical vehicle for guitarist Steve Kimock and drummer Rodney Holmes. Long time listeners know that SKB thrives on improvisational live performances characterized by extended interplay among an everchanging set of extraordinary musicians. Eudemonic is a studio recording that documents one incarnation of SKB that included Alphonso Johnson (bass) and Mitch Stein (more guitar).

This album is a perfect introduction to Kimock. Eudemonic contains the essence of nine compositions by Kimock and/or Holmes. The standout track is The Bronx Experiment. This composition demonstrates the range of SKB's use of instrumentation and melodic themes.

Steve has spent his career perfecting guitar technique and tone. Fans know that live performance is the best way to enjoy the Steve Kimock Band. Quality recordings of these performances can be downloaded from either DigitalSoundboard.net or the Live Music Archive (http://www.archive.org/audio/etree.php). These recordings contain the music as well as audience participation. The studio album contains just the music. So, the trade off is between longer explorations of compositions with improvisation and crowd noise or a tight, studio recording with just the music. Eudemonic is not to be missed.

5.0 out of 5 stars Beautiful..., September 5, 2005
This CD is just a beautiful aural soundscape and a great example of why fans of Kimock just keep coming back for more "K-Waves". The song versions are different than what Kimock fans are used to live, but one shouldn't expect a studio disc to sound live. The disc manages to showcase Steve Kimock's virtuoso playing and dedication to flow and tone extremely well. My favorites are an exploratory "Ice Cream," the middle-eastern sounding "Bronx Experiment" played on the Octave Mandolin, and just a gorgeous "In Reply." But every cut on this disc is right on. Play it loud, listen carefully, and you won't be disappointed.
